What Are 45 Containers?
A 45-foot container becomes part of the ISO (International Organization for Standardization) specifications for cargo containers. Generally constructed from resilient steel, these containers are designed to endure diverse ecological conditions. Their extended length of 45 feet, compared to the more common 20-foot and 40-foot containers, enables for greater cargo capacity while preserving a standardized design.
Standard Specifications of 45 ContainersSpecDetailsExternal Length45 feet (13.7 meters)External Width8 feet (2.44 meters)External Height9.5 feet (2.9 meters)Internal Dimensions Of 45 Ft Container Length44.5 feet (13.56 meters)Internal Width7.7 feet (2.35 meters)Internal Height8.5 feet (2.59 meters)Maximum PayloadUsually around 30,000 to 33,000 pounds (13,607 to 14,969 kg)Tare WeightAround 8,500 to 9,500 pounds (3,856 to 4,309 kg)Uses of 45 Containers

How do I transfer a 45-foot container?
Transferring a 45-foot container usually requires a flatbed truck or a specialized shipping container transport service. It's important to examine local regulations concerning container transportation and ensure that you employ skilled professionals.
2. Can I customize a 45 container for individual usage?
Yes, lots of people choose to customize containers for personal tasks such as homes, studios, or workplaces. However, guarantee that any modifications comply with regional building regulations and guidelines.
3. What is the cost of renting vs. purchasing a 45 container?
Expenses can differ considerably depending on area, condition, and availability. Leasing a 45 container typically varies from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 per month, while acquiring one can range from 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 7,000 or more, depending on condition and adjustments.
4. Are 45 containers waterproof and weatherproof?
When sealed appropriately, 45 containers are created to be waterproof and resistant to weather conditions. However, it's recommended to carry out routine upkeep checks to guarantee they remain in good condition.
5. How can I ensure my container is safe and secure?
To boost the security of a 45 container, think about utilizing sturdy locks, security seals, and area in a well-lit or monitored location. Some owner-operators likewise install alarm for added defense.
